Rossiya A319 at St. Petersburg on Jan 28th 2015, cabin did not pressurize

An Rossiya Airbus A319-100, registration VQ-BAR performing flight FV-6805 from St. Petersburg (Russia) to Astana (Kazakhstan), was climbing out of St. Petersburg's runway 28L when the crew stopped the climb at about 12,000 feet and descended to 10,000 feet again due to the cabin not properly pressurizing. The aircraft returned to St. Petersburg for a safe landing on runway 28L about 70 minutes after departure.
